Regenerative, beyond organic farm that provides weekly CSA offerings to Colorado Springs, Fountain, Monument, Peyton, Central Denver, and Woodland Park. While most locations are vegan friendly, the Central Colorado Springs market is located inside Ranch Foods, a local meat market. If you want to keep your experience free of meat, pick up your CSA items at one of the other locations. Pick-up locations: North Colorado Springs/Monument, Thursday 11:30 am to 12:30 pm. Central Denver: Thursday 3:00 to 4:00 pm. On the farm itself: Friday 9:00 am to Noon. Central Colorado Springs: Friday 3:00 to 6:00 pm. Fountain: Friday 4:00 to 5:00 pm. Woodland Park: Friday 4:00 pm to 6:00 pm. Hours vary based on pickup location. Quality, local, organic produce

This farm is local and boasts a regenerative, beyond organic harvest. Their prices are affordable for everyone; they accept SNAP and offer pay-what-you-can-afford for extra produce each week. The only downside is the locale for the Central Colorado Springs pickup—the inside of a meat market. If you want to keep your experience free of meat, pick up your CSA items at one of the other locations.

Pros: Local, Organic, Affordable

Cons: One pickup location is inside a meat market
